Inuvo, Inc. reported its financial results for the third quarter of 2025, revealing a slight increase in revenue and a continued net loss. The company generated $22.57 million in revenue for the three months ended September 30, 2025, a 0.9% increase from $22.37 million in the same period last year. For the nine-month period, revenue rose significantly by 24.9% to $71.95 million, compared to $57.60 million in 2024. Despite this growth, Inuvo's cost of revenue surged by 131.3% in the third quarter, leading to a gross profit decline of 16.2% to $16.57 million.

The company's operating expenses also saw a decrease, totaling $18.24 million for the third quarter, down from $21.72 million in the prior year, primarily due to reduced marketing costs. However, Inuvo still reported an operating loss of $1.67 million for the quarter, an improvement from the $1.94 million loss in the same period last year. The net loss for the quarter was $1.74 million, compared to a loss of $2.04 million in the third quarter of 2024. The company attributed the improved performance to a combination of increased revenue from its Agency & Brands segment and a strategic focus on cost management.

Inuvo's operational metrics indicate a strong reliance on its Platform clients, which accounted for 82.8% of total revenue in the third quarter. The company noted that two major clients represented 62.8% and 19.6% of its revenue, highlighting a significant customer concentration risk. The company has been actively working on expanding its product offerings, particularly its AI-driven advertising technology, IntentKey, which aims to enhance audience targeting without relying on consumer data.

The company’s liquidity position improved, with cash and cash equivalents rising to $3.38 million as of September 30, 2025, compared to $2.46 million at the end of 2024. Inuvo has also entered into a Financing Agreement with SLR Digital Finance LLC, allowing it to borrow against eligible accounts receivable, with an outstanding balance of $3.38 million as of the reporting date. Management expressed optimism about future revenue growth, particularly as it adapts to changes in client policies and continues to develop its AI capabilities. However, they acknowledged the ongoing challenges of achieving profitability and the potential need for additional funding through equity or debt financing in the future.

About Inuvo, Inc.

Inuvo is an advertising technology company specializing in AI-driven solutions that identify and target digital audiences without consumer data. Its proprietary IntentKey platform leverages large language generative AI to optimize ad placement across multiple channels and devices, serving agencies, brands, and media platforms. The company focuses on disrupting traditional advertising models by addressing privacy regulations and technological shifts, offering managed and SaaS solutions in a competitive, innovation-driven industry.

About 10-Q Filings

A 10-Q form is an important financial report that public companies in the United States must submit every three months. It gives a clear picture of a company's financial health and recent performance.

Key points about the 10-Q:

  • Frequency: Companies file it three times a year, covering the first three quarters. The fourth quarter is covered in a more comprehensive annual report.
  • Content: It includes:
    • Financial statements showing the company's current financial position
    • Updates from management on the performance and projections of the business
    • Information about potential risks the company faces
    • Details on how the company is run internally
  • Deadline: Must be filed within 40 or 45 days after the quarter ends, depending on the size of the company.
